    I recently had my wedding here in July , we fit just under 150 people in the upper room. It turned…read moreout beautiful beyond expectations. If you are considering booking your wedding here you should expect too pay a couple hundred more than they tell you initially , also there is a ton of random furniture that they are not willing to move , our solution was to rent a movie theater curtain and hang it with scaffolding cutting off about 10 ft of the room, and than moved all the furniture behind it. We than put the head table and front and it ended up looking better than if we had not. Overall I would give 2 stars , for lack of communication on their part, because we were told many different on many things by different employees on what time we could get there to set up , if we could move the furniture out , and the random sum of charges that weren't mentioned until after our event The furniture problem cause a big set back the morning of our wedding so I hope our solution helps you (: I would however give 5 stars for beauty in the end , because with enough work , communication and decorating it can be a very lovely venue
